The long-awaited switchover from Proof of Work to Proof of Stake, known as The Merge, has finally taken place on Ethereum. This transition has resulted in Ethereum running on 99.5% less energy and experiencing a 90% lower inflation rate. However, with this major milestone achieved, the Ethereum community now faces the question of what comes next.
One key aspect that Ethereum aims to address is its computing capacity. Through the use of Sharding technology, Ethereum can scale out its computing power without increasing the computational demands on stakers. Sharding involves splitting the database into multiple shards, each processed by separate machines. This approach is still being debated, but it is expected that future Ethereum Improvement Proposals (EIPs) like EIP-4844 will provide strategies for maintaining Ethereum's security and composability while implementing sharding.
Another challenge that Ethereum faces is the maintenance of the full Ethereum "state" by validators. Currently, validators must have access to the entire historical record of the chain, which can become prohibitively expensive as the state grows. To address this, Ethereum is working towards a stateless network validation approach. This involves shifting from the current Merkle-tree-based validation to a newer concept called "Verkle Trees." Verkle trees compress the data required for validating a block based on historical data, making stateless clients viable in practice.
In terms of changing minds and beliefs, humans have a natural tendency to hold onto beliefs that bring them allies, protectors, or disciples, rather than beliefs that are most likely to be true. Belonging to a group is crucial for survival, and people often prioritize social ties over facts. Convincing someone to change their mind is not just about presenting facts, but about providing them with an alternative tribe where they can feel a sense of belonging.
The closest relationships have the most significant impact on our beliefs. The beliefs of those closest to us can shape our own thinking. This is why books, which allow for internal conversations without judgment, can be powerful tools for transforming beliefs. Ideas need to be repeated and shared to be remembered and believed. Therefore, instead of wasting time tearing down bad ideas, it is more productive to champion good ideas and share them with others.
In the process of changing someone's mind, it is essential to approach the conversation with kindness. Arguing to win often breaks down the reality of the person you are arguing against, causing them to become defensive. Developing a friendship, sharing a meal, or gifting a book can create a psychologically safe environment where open-mindedness and change can occur.
